JURY GIVES CISCO MAN 40 YEARS FOR MULTIPLE FELONY CHARGES

Yahel Eliyah McDaniel, 28, FORMALLY of Cisco, was convicted of five felony offenses and one misdemeanor offense by an Eastland County Jury ON MAY 5, 2021 IN THE 91ST DISTRICT COURT. McDaniel pled “Guilty” to the felony charges of Unauthorized use of Motor Vehicle, Evading Arrest or Detention with Vehicle, Possession of a Controlled Substance: Methamphetamine more than 1 gram, but less 4 four grams, and the misdemeanor offense of Deadly Conduct, and chose the jury to set his punishment in all his cases. McDaniel entered a plea of “Not Guilty” to the more serious First-Degree offenses of Aggravated Assault Against a Public Servant – Deadly Weapon - Threaten and Aggravated Robbery. the jury, after hearing all the evidence, returned a quick verdict of “guilty” on all charges.
